Cognitive Behavioral (CBT)
I use Cognitive Behavioral therapy to help my clients change unhelpful or unhealthy ways of thinking, feeling, and behaving. I teach practical self-help strategies that are designed to improve the quality of the client's life. I use CBT as an effective way to treat depression and anxiety. CBT aims to stop negative cycles such as depression and anxiety by breaking down things that make clients feel bad, scared and anxious. CBT help clients make problems more manageable. CBT can help change clients negative thought patterns and improve the way they feel.
